Daniel Rosas Reyes (born September 18, 1989 in Mexico City, Distrito Federal, Mexico) is an undefeated Mexican professional boxer in the Bantamweight.

Pro career

In February 2010, Rosas beat the undefeated Juan Carlos Sanchez, Jr. by T.K.O. to win the WBC CABOFE Super Flyweight Championship. The bout was the main-event of a boxing card at the Complejo Panamericano in Guadalajara, Jalisco, Mexico.

In December 2010, Rosas beat the undefeated Felipe Orucuta by UD to win "Campeon Azteca Tecate".
